Main features of Light Fully Automatic Solar Cleaning Machine

Fall prevention system, no fear of falling at any control.
The photovoltaic cleaning robot may fall off the photovoltaic panel due to misoperation and other reasons, resulting in loss or danger!
The front and rear ends are equipped with four high-precision sensors, which will automatically stop when moving forward or backward to the blank area on the edge of the photovoltaic panel, and the drop detection indicator light will light up. At this time, only the remote controller can be operated to drive
away in the opposite direction, effectively avoiding the risk of falling.
150m remote control cleaning to avoid personnel risks.
Cleaning personnel standing on the photovoltaic panel or walking on the roof have certain safety risks! The remote control distance of robot is150 meters,which is easy and safer. Adopting imported RF remote control technology, the signal is more stable and the anti-interference ability is stronger than that of conventionalcommunication technology;


High-site design has superior obstacle-surmounting ability
Excellent anti-skid and passability are adopted, and the un-evenness is still flat. The robot adopts imported rubber anti-skid crawler to adapt to the inclination angle within 15, and the maximum passing distance is 15cm.

Full Function Integration
Combining cleaning and inspection into one, to assist in efficient operation and maintenance of power stations.
Built-in a high-definition camera and high computing power GPU module, it can visually inspect photovoltaic modules while cleaning, and automatically identify and label abnormal information such as broken components and misplaced blocks, greatly improving the operation and maintenance efficiency of photovoltaic power plants.


Full View Monitoring
Real-time visible power generation data, clear cleaning effect at a glance.
The cleaning robot can be centrally managed through a mini-program, allowing real-time viewing of the power station cleaning plan, progress, and effectiveness. It can also integrate a photovoltaic monitoring system to compare and analyze the power generation efficiency improvement effect brought by cleaning, truly achieving visual cleaning.

FAQ
1. Will the robot hit walls or obstacles during operation?
Answer: This will not happen under normal circumstances. Human operations will be controlled by humans. This requires the person using the robot to basically understand how to operate the robot. The fully automatic system will be controlled by induction and there will be no collision.
2. After the rooftop photovoltaic is installed, can it work on rainy days?
Answer: Fully automatic equipment can be operated on rainy days, but human-operated equipment cannot be cleaned on rainy days. It is mainly to protect people's safety and prevent lightning and other unsafe things from happening.
3. Which robots can be made into crawlers? Low cost?
Answer: Both are possible. The main purpose of the crawler tracks is that they have high cleaning friction and a good cleaning effect.

5. If leaves or other things fall on the photovoltaic panels, can it be seen by the amount of electricity generated?
Answer: Debris in a large area is fine. Under normal circumstances, photovoltaic panels have a system for monitoring power generation, which can be judged by changes in power generation. Debris in a small area may not necessarily be monitored.
